logo

Output 68bc6622f78b26202e63f5e3ceaade74697577b735454a97a14ba9b14b0f88b3:22

value
102372
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c4194bc7d3b8e45da60a20d9731e46e3787ec85 OP_EQUALVERIFY OP_CHECKSIG
address
13aQV27EDzp4RNoiP8TzmuSWtuQbyCFrG5
transaction
68bc6622f78b26202e63f5e3ceaade74697577b735454a97a14ba9b14b0f88b3